Rowand’s Home Run Sparks Titans Past Northridge
- Share via
Aaron Rowand’s home run in the eighth inning broke a tie and Cal State Fullerton went on to defeat Cal State Northridge, 6-4, Tuesday night at Titan Field.
Pete Fukuhara added a two-run homer in the eighth and Reed Johnson drove in the other three runs for Fullerton (11-6).
George Carralejo (1-0) earned the victory with three shutout innings of relief for the Titans.
In other nonconference baseball:
Azusa Pacific 9, Chapman 7--Consecutive home runs by Carlos De La Trinidad and Matt Lewallen in the second inning capped a three-run inning for Azusa Pacific.
John Knott had three hits, an RBI and a run for Azusa Pacific (9-2-1).
Robert O’Brien had four hits, including a home run, one run and three RBIs for Chapman (8-4).
Concordia 13, Westmont 1--Ben Kindreich posted four RBIs along with three hits and a triple for host Concordia (5-7).
In the Golden State Athletic Conference women’s basketball playoffs:
Concordia 85, California Baptist College 70--Concordia, seeded third, advanced to the semifinals of the GSAC playoffs against Fresno Pacific University Friday. Cal Baptist (12-16, 3-9) cut Concordia’s lead to 54-50 with 13 minutes remaining, but the Eagles went on an 18-4 run over the next six minutes to break the game open.
Concordia (23-8, 8-4) was led by Priscilla Bendik, who had 19 points and Jaime Gast, who led all scoring with 21.
In Mountain Pacific Sports Federation men’s volleyball:
BYU 3, UC Irvine 0--Oswald Antonetti had 30 kills as BYU defeated UC Irvine, 16-14, 15-13, 15-8. Teammate Chris Pitzak had 78 assists for BYU (7-2, 7-2).
Mike Rupp had 21 kills and Cory Weber had 18 kills for the Anteaters (8-5, 5-5).
